🔑 Car Key & Fob FAQ

Common questions about key programming, fob issues, and replacement options

Key Fob Issues
Many cars have a resync procedure: 1) Press lock/unlock buttons while near the car 2) Insert key and turn ignition on/off in a specific pattern 3) Use a sequence of button presses. Check your manual for exact steps - procedures vary widely by manufacturer.

Security Systems
Not recommended. Bypassing requires specialized knowledge and may violate anti-theft laws. Proper solutions: 1) Get correctly programmed keys 2) Replace faulty immobilizer components 3) Have dealer reset the system if keys are lost.

Lost Keys
Costs vary widely: Basic keys: $50-$150, Transponder keys: $150-$300, Smart keys/fobs: $200-$800, Dealership replacements typically cost 20-50% more than locksmiths. Emergency/lockout service adds $50-$150.
Key Programming
Professional key programming requires: diagnostic tools to access the immobilizer system, key code software, transponder programmers, and often proprietary manufacturer equipment. Some locksmiths and all dealers have these tools.
Key Fob Issues
Sometimes. Broken buttons can often be fixed by cleaning or replacing the button pad. Cracked cases can be glued. However, water damage or circuit board issues usually require complete fob replacement. Reprogramming is still needed for replacement fobs.
